In а study published in the April 9 issue оf the jоurnаl Neurоlogy, this triаl is the first in humans to show that recovering memory after brain injury is harder for people who have the E4 type of the apolipoprotein E (APOE) gene, which is already known to influence Alzheimer's disease. . . . The study looked at 110 head injury patients who were rated for level of traumatic brain injury, assessed for memory function and genotyped at the APOE gene. Although participants with the E4 form of the APOE gene matched those without the E4 form in terms of age, gender and severity of injury, there were clear differences in memory function between the two groups. The E4 group showed worse recovery of general memory function after injury.
